Galleria Continua showcased a solo exhibition featuring Jannis Kounellis, a prominent figure in Italian post-war art with a career spanning approximately three and a half decades. Kounellis has left his mark on the global art scene, having worked across five continents and found his place in some of the most esteemed art collections and museums worldwide.

Kounellis’ artistic journey was marked by his early exploration of a new spatial dimension. He discovered a significant amount of coal piled on the floor of his studio and recognized it as a key element in redefining artistic practice. He ventured into using materials that were typically non-pictorial, drawn directly from real life. This choice introduced him to the forms, colors, and unique scents of natural or technological elements. These materials were then transformed into poetic energies through the mechanisms of imagination, mythology, culture, classical and religious ideals, and passionate expression.
